A dry box won't be dry even if you make it airtight, because there's water vapor inside already. Either constantly heat it up and use a lot of power, or use a desiccant to absorb the moisture. I use silica gel with indicator, which changes color once the silica has absorbed all the water it could, so I know when it needs drying up. We'll have to wait and see how long it can stay dry for. The box is still not finished. It needs a few tweaks and more tests to check for airflow over time and improve how long it can stay dry for. During the day with temperature variation there will be a little bit of air moving in and out, bringing more moisture, and at some point I'll have to replace or dry up the silica. We'll have to see if it can stay relatively dry for at least a month.
